The project focuses on developing advanced agile antennas using micro-nano devices for communication, safety, and security applications. It aims to create prototypes that integrate numerous phase-controlling switches for enhanced performance in high-frequency operations.
ARASCOM OBJECTIVES<br/>Our project is focused on Research & Development for efficient use of micro-nano devices as basis of agile antennas with moderate cost, that are more and more required in advanced systems for Communication, Safety and Security.
